As I attended a Journey concert last night here in Dallas, watching the band
perform a flawless show, I was struck by the band’s lead singer, Arnel Pinela. He replaced the band’s
legendary vocalist, Steve Perry, and has had a tremendous climb to win the hearts and minds of Journey fans the world over.
However, what I find most remarkable about him is how he
came into the roll as lead singer. It was as simple as literally being discovered by Journey guitar icon,
Neal Schon, on YouTube. Pinela’s friend, Noel Gomez, who had been posting videos of Arnel’s
performances with his Journey cover band in the Philippines, was contacted by Schon and wanted to get in touch with Pinela,
who thought the contact was some sort of gag and blew it off.
I mean, wouldn’t you?
Long story short, Neal and Arnel met and began the trek to bring the Filipino vocalist
into one of America’s premier and legendary rock bands. How cool is that?
